Old Dominion Freight Line, Inc. (FRA:ODF)
Germany flag Germany · Delayed Price · Currency is EUR
144.35
+0.35 (0.24%)
At close: Jan 29, 2026

Old Dominion Freight Line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
30,48336,37740,01229,33736,24318,721
Market Cap Growth
-21.38%-9.09%36.39%-19.05%93.59%38.69%
Enterprise Value
30,51536,36339,89829,07935,83418,412
Last Close Price
143.40172.58182.01131.05154.5176.64
PE Ratio
33.8231.7535.6822.7739.8534.04
PS Ratio
6.426.487.545.017.845.70
PB Ratio
8.398.8710.398.5811.206.89
P/TBV Ratio
8.398.8710.398.5811.206.89
P/FCF Ratio
38.8442.4154.4834.2162.2132.35
P/OCF Ratio
24.4822.7028.1918.5333.9924.55
EV/Sales Ratio
6.506.477.524.967.755.61
EV/EBITDA Ratio
20.4319.9322.4414.6824.6819.28
EV/EBIT Ratio
26.0724.3826.8816.8829.2924.83
EV/FCF Ratio
38.8942.4054.3233.9161.5131.81
Debt / Equity Ratio
0.020.040.050.050.060.06
Debt / EBITDA Ratio
0.050.090.100.090.120.17
Debt / FCF Ratio
0.090.190.250.220.310.29
Asset Turnover
1.021.061.131.301.140.96
Quick Ratio
1.061.181.931.592.843.18
Current Ratio
1.201.332.101.762.983.33
Return on Equity (ROE)
25.06%27.90%31.34%37.56%29.53%21.00%
Return on Assets (ROA)
15.89%17.54%19.81%23.82%18.93%13.55%
Return on Invested Capital (ROIC)
24.36%28.23%32.31%40.60%34.75%24.22%
Return on Capital Employed (ROCE)
28.00%31.20%33.00%42.70%31.90%22.70%
Earnings Yield
2.96%3.15%2.80%4.39%2.51%2.94%
FCF Yield
2.57%2.36%1.84%2.92%1.61%3.09%
Dividend Yield
0.69%0.58%0.40%0.43%0.23%0.32%
Payout Ratio
22.00%18.85%14.13%9.77%8.93%10.56%
Buyback Yield / Dilution
2.29%1.68%2.64%2.86%1.76%1.75%
Total Shareholder Return
2.98%2.26%3.04%3.29%1.99%2.08%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.